Ford's CEO said Chinese carmakers entering the US would be 'devastating'
Ford's CEO said Bill Pugliano/Getty Images Ford's CEO Jim Farley said Chinese cars entering the US would be "devastating" for the US car industry. He said manufacturing was the "heart and soul" of the US, and Chinese exports could hurt it. Farley has talked about the robustness of China's automobiles several times in recent years.
